Budapest-based label Exiles have brought together artists from near and far for their annual compilation, which focuses this time on the sonic exploration of maritime fantasies. Titled Sirens the 20-track release features contributions from the likes of Arexibo, Mala Herba, Thea Soti and our pick from MA’AM, who sonically drift through the realms of dark ambient, chamber music, choral, drone and experimental.
All digital purchases will be donated to The Women For Women Together Against Violence Association (NANE), a non-profit NGO that was established in 1994 with the aim to fight violence against women and children.
